While cultivators are highly effective, users may encounter some common issues. Here are some solutions:
| Problem | Solution |
|---|---|
| Soil is too hard | Pre-soak the soil before cultivation or use a more powerful cultivator. |
| Clogs and jams | Regularly check and clean the blades, especially in heavy clay soils. |
| Uneven cultivation | Practice consistent speed and adjust the depth settings as needed. |
| Weeds persisting | Combine cultivator use with herbicides or manual weeding for best results. |
